The synthesis and spectral properties of new radioiodinated phenylalkylamines like 2‐[ 131 I]‐iodo‐4,5‐dimethoxyphenethylamine, 2‐[ 131 I]‐iodo‐4,5‐dimethoxy‐ N , N ‐dimethyl‐phenethylamine 2‐[ 131 I]‐iodophenethylamine, 2‐[ 131 I]‐iodo‐ N , N ‐dimethylphenethylamine, 2‐[ 131 I]‐iodo‐3,4,5‐trimethoxy‐phenethylamine (mescaline) are described for the first time. These compounds are of biological importance and can be used for brain mapping with SPECT technology. © 1998 John Wiley & Sons, Ltd.
